>>> HI All,
>>>
>>> Thanks Beran for checking the dates.  I see no problems with most of the
>>> dates except for the ICANN75 Annual General Meeting    15 – 21 October 2022
>>> falls near the end of the Jewish Holiday season and there is one/two day
>>> that falls during a Jewish holiday that is the holiday of Shmini Atzeret
>>> (eighth day of Assembly) and Simchat Torah (Celebration of the Torah) these
>>> two holidays are added to the end of the Jewish Holiday of Sukkot -Festival
>>> of the Booths.  It would be good to add this issue to the comments in the
>>> effort not to impinge on any persons religious observances

>>> I must say I am happy to say the none of the 2021 and 2022 meetings will
>>> fall during the muslim month of Ramadan. However, the 2023 Community Forum
>>> will be at the beginning of Ramadan. Perhaps good to add that to the
>>> comments.
